[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of pipe pile welding, and in particular to an automatic pipe pile welding device. Background Art
[0002] Pipe piles are a type of foundation material used in buildings. They are typically sunk into the ground to serve as load-bearing structures. In some special construction situations, longer pipe piles are required. For example, at wind turbine construction sites, due to the limited length of a single pipe pile, two or more pipe piles must be welded together to meet on-site construction requirements.
[0003] Existing pipe pile welding mainly relies on manual handheld welding guns, which has a low degree of automation and easily leads to unstable pipe pile welding quality. Currently, there is an urgent need for a welding device that can automatically weld pipe piles to stabilize the quality of pipe pile on-site welding. Summary of the Invention

DETAILED DESCRIPTION
[0050] The following is combined with Figure 1-5 This application is described in further detail.
[0051] The embodiment of the present application discloses an automatic welding device for pipe piles. Figure 1 A pipe pile automatic welding device includes a first fixing ring 1, a second fixing ring 2, a mounting frame 3, a welding gun 4 and a cleaning grinding head 5.
[0052] A first fixing ring 1 is mounted on one of the piles. Four first fixing cylinders 11 are fixedly connected to the inner wall of the first fixing ring 1. The movable ends of the first fixing cylinders 11 are used to press against the pile. A second fixing ring 2 is mounted on the other pile. Four second fixing cylinders 21 are fixedly connected to the inner wall of the second fixing ring 2. The movable ends of the second fixing cylinders 21 are rotatably connected to rollers 22, which are used to press against the pile. The first fixing ring 1 is fixed relative to the pile, while the second fixing ring 2 is rotatable relative to the pile. This allows the second fixing ring 2 to rotate the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 around the pile, using the first fixing ring 1 as support.
[0053] There are two mounting frames 3, both of which are arranged between the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2. The mounting frames 3 include support rods 31 and mounting slides 32. There are two support rods 31, both of which are slidably inserted into the mounting slides 32. One end of the support rod 31 is fixed to the second fixing ring 2, and the other end can slide relative to the first fixing ring 1. The welding gun 4 is mounted on one of the mounting slides 32, and the position of the welding gun 4 is adjusted as the mounting slide 32 slides. The cleaning grinding head 5 is mounted on the other mounting slide 32, and the position of the cleaning grinding head 5 is adjusted as the mounting slide 32 slides. By providing the mounting frame 3, the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 can be easily rotated with the second fixing ring 2, and the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 can be moved to the welding position of the two pipe piles.
[0054] The cleaning grinding head 5 is a flexible grinding and sweeping member. For example, the cleaning grinding head 5 is made of brushed cloth, or the interior of the cleaning grinding head 5 is made of sponge and the outer surface is made of corundum.
[0055] A fixing assembly 6 is commonly provided on the two installation slides 32 . The fixing assembly 6 is used to fix the installation slides 32 relative to the support rod 31 by means of the pressing force of the first fixing oil cylinder 11 against the pipe pile.
[0056] An adjustment assembly 7 is commonly provided on the two mounting slides 32, and the adjustment assembly 7 is used to adjust the position of the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 based on the movement of the movable end of the second fixed oil cylinder 21, so that the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 can be moved to the welding working position just right.
[0057] Reference Figure 2A driving assembly 8 is commonly provided on the first fixing ring 1, the second fixing ring 2 and the two mounting frames 3. The driving assembly 8 includes a first driving part 81 and a second driving part 82. The first driving part 81 is used to drive the second fixing ring 2 and the two mounting frames 3 to rotate around the pipe pile, and the second driving part 82 is used to drive the cleaning grinding head 5 to rotate with the help of the driving force generated by the rotation of the mounting frame 3.
[0058] When in use, the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 are respectively placed on the two pipe piles, and the installation slide 32 is slid so that the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 are aligned with the welding positions of the two pipe piles. The first fixing oil cylinder 11 and the second fixing oil cylinder 21 are extended to automatically fix the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 on the pipe piles. The fixing assembly 6 uses the pressing force of the first fixing oil cylinder 11 to press against the pipe pile to fix the installation slide 32 relative to the support rod 31, so as to realize the automatic fixation of the position of the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5.
[0059] The adjusting component 7 moves the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 to the welding working position based on the movement of the movable end of the second fixed oil cylinder 21, so as to realize automatic adjustment of the welding working position of the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5. The first driving part 81 drives the second fixed ring 2 and the two mounting frames 3 to rotate around the pipe pile, so that the cleaning grinding head 5 and the welding gun 4 can automatically clean and weld the welding positions of the two pipe piles. The second driving part 82 can drive the cleaning grinding head 5 to rotate with the driving force generated by the rotation of the mounting frame 3, so that the cleaning grinding head 5 can rotate and grind by relying on the rotation of the mounting frame 3. After installing the first fixed ring 1 and the second fixed ring 2 and adjusting the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 to the welding position of the pipe pile, the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 can automatically realize the position fixing, position adjustment and cleaning welding operations, thereby improving the degree of automation of on-site welding of pipe piles, reducing the degree of manual intervention, and thus stabilizing the quality of on-site welding of pipe piles.
[0060] Since the extension lengths of the first fixing cylinder 11 and the second fixing cylinder 21 can be adjusted, the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 can be fixed on pipe piles of different diameters, so that the welding device can be used to weld pipe piles of different diameters.
[0061] In particular, refer to Figure 2 The first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 have the same structure. The first fixing ring 1 includes two fixing half rings 12. One end of the two fixing half rings 12 is hinged and the other end is detachably connected.
[0062] A padlock hasp 13 is provided between the ends of the two fixed half rings 12 away from the hinge. The hook body of the padlock hasp 13 is fixedly connected to one of the fixed half rings 12, and the lock body of the padlock hasp 13 is fixedly connected to the other fixed half ring 12. The padlock hasp 13 forms a detachable connection structure of the two fixed half rings 12.
[0063] Since the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 can be disassembled into two fixing half rings 12, the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 can be easily sleeved on the pipe pile, thereby improving the installation convenience of the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2.
[0064] Specifically, refer to Figure 2 and Figure 3 The fixing assembly 6 includes a flexible box 61 , a double-headed oil cylinder 62 and a fixing pipe 63 .
[0065] Four flexible boxes 61 are provided, each correspondingly fixed to the movable end of the first fixed oil cylinder 11. The movable end of the first fixed oil cylinder 11 is pressed against the side wall of the pile by the flexible boxes 61, increasing the contact force between the movable end of the first fixed oil cylinder 11 and the pile. Two double-ended oil cylinders 62 are provided, each correspondingly fixed within the clearance holes 321 provided in the mounting slide 32. Flexible blocks 621 are fixed to each movable end of the double-ended oil cylinder 62.
[0066] One end of a fixed tube 63 is connected to all of the flexible boxes 61, and the other end is connected to the center of both double-ended cylinders 62. This tube 63 allows a first fluid medium to flow between the flexible boxes 61 and the center of the double-ended cylinders 62. Both rod chambers of the double-ended cylinders 62 are connected to the atmosphere. When the flexible boxes 61 are squeezed, the first fluid medium drives the two movable ends of the double-ended cylinders 62 to extend synchronously. In this application, the first fluid medium is hydraulic oil.
[0067] Each mounting platform 32 is equipped with two fixed gears 64, located on the opposite side of the two flexible blocks 621. The fixed gears 64 are rotatably connected to the mounting platform 32 and located within the clearance holes 321. Each fixed gear 64 is engaged with a fixed rack 65, which is fixedly attached to the support rod 31 adjacent to the fixed gear 64. When the flexible box 61 is pressed against the pile, the flexible blocks 621 press against the fixed gears 64, forcing them into the tooth grooves of the fixed gears 64, thus restricting their rotation.
[0068] When the movable end of the first fixed oil cylinder 11 drives the flexible box 61 to press against the pipe pile to fix the first fixed ring 1, the hydraulic oil in the flexible box 61 can be squeezed to the middle of the double-headed oil cylinder 62 to drive the two movable ends of the double-headed oil cylinder 62 to extend synchronously, so that the flexible block 621 on the movable end of the double-headed oil cylinder 62 can be squeezed into the tooth groove of the fixed gear 64, making it difficult for the fixed gear 64 to rotate relative to the mounting slide 32. Since the fixed gear 64 is engaged with the fixed rack 65, the mounting slide 32 can be automatically fixed to the support rod 31.
[0069] Further, refer to Figure 3 A first spring 66 is provided in each of the two rod cavities of the double-headed oil cylinder 62. One end of the first spring 66 is fixedly connected to the fixed end of the double-headed oil cylinder 62, and the other end is fixedly connected to the movable end of the double-headed oil cylinder 62. The first spring 66 is used to drive the movable end of the double-headed oil cylinder 62 to contract.
[0070] When it is necessary to release the restriction of the flexible block 621 on the fixed gear 64, the first fixed cylinder 11 is contracted, and the first spring 66 can drive the double-headed cylinder 62 to contract through the elastic force. The double-headed cylinder 62 can drive the flexible block 621 away from the fixed gear 64 to release the restriction of the flexible block 621 on the fixed gear 64.
[0071] Specifically, refer to Figure 2 、 Figure 3 and Figure 4 The adjusting assembly 7 includes a first adjusting cylinder 71 , a first adjusting pipe 72 , a second adjusting cylinder 73 and a second adjusting pipe 74 .
[0072] Reference Figure 2 and Figure 4 The first adjustment cylinder 71 is fixedly connected to the mounting slide 32 where the welding gun 4 is located. The welding gun 4 is fixedly connected to the movable end of the first adjustment cylinder 71, and the rod cavity of the first adjustment cylinder 71 is connected to the atmosphere. One end of the first adjustment tube 72 is connected to the rodless cavity of the first adjustment cylinder 71, and the other end is connected to the rod cavities of all second fixed cylinders 21. The first adjustment tube 72 is used to allow the second fluid medium to flow between the rodless cavity of the first adjustment cylinder 71 and the rod cavities of the second fixed cylinders 21. The first adjustment cylinder 71 can adjust the position of the welding gun 4 under the control of the second fixed cylinders 21.
[0073] Reference Figure 2 and Figure 3 The second adjusting cylinder 73 is fixedly connected to the mounting slide 32 where the cleaning grinding head 5 is located. The cleaning grinding head 5 is connected to the movable end of the second adjusting cylinder 73, and the rod cavity of the second adjusting cylinder 73 is connected to the atmosphere. One end of the second adjusting tube 74 is connected to the rodless cavity of the second adjusting cylinder 73, and the other end is connected to the rod cavities of all the second fixed cylinders 21. The second adjusting tube 74 is used to allow a second fluid medium to flow between the rodless cavity of the second adjusting cylinder 73 and the rod cavity of the second fixed cylinder 21. The second fluid medium is hydraulic oil in this application. The second adjusting cylinder 73 can adjust the position of the cleaning grinding head 5 under the drive of the second fixed cylinder 21.
[0074] When the second fixed oil cylinder 21 is extended to make the roller 22 abut against the pipe pile, the second fixed oil cylinder 21 can drive the first adjusting oil cylinder 71 and the second adjusting oil cylinder 73 to extend through hydraulic oil, the first adjusting oil cylinder 71 drives the welding gun 4 to move, and the second adjusting oil cylinder 73 drives the cleaning grinding head 5 to move, so that the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 can realize automatic adjustment of the welding working position under the drive of the second fixed oil cylinder 21.
[0075] Further, refer to Figure 3 and Figure 4 The adjustment assembly 7 further includes a second spring 75 and a third spring 76. The second spring 75 is disposed within the rod cavity of the first adjustment cylinder 71. One end of the second spring 75 is fixedly connected to the fixed end of the first adjustment cylinder 71, and the other end is fixedly connected to the movable end of the first adjustment cylinder 71. The second spring 75 is used to drive the first adjustment cylinder 71 to retract. The third spring 76 is disposed within the rod cavity of the second adjustment cylinder 73. One end of the third spring 76 is fixedly connected to the fixed end of the second adjustment cylinder 73, and the other end is fixedly connected to the movable end of the second adjustment cylinder 73. The third spring 76 is used to drive the second adjustment cylinder 73 to retract.
[0076] After the second fixed oil cylinder 21 drives the first adjusting oil cylinder 71 and the second adjusting oil cylinder 73 to extend, the second spring 75 and the third spring 76 can accumulate elastic force. When it is necessary to reset the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5, the driving force of the second fixed oil cylinder 21 is released. Under the elastic force of the second spring 75 and the third spring 76, the first adjusting oil cylinder 71 and the second adjusting oil cylinder 73 can be retracted, so that the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 can be automatically reset.
[0077] Specifically, refer to Figure 2 and Figure 4 The first driving part 81 includes a guide groove 811, a ring gear 812, a first rotating shaft 813, a first gear 814, a second gear 815, a third gear 816 and a motor 817.
[0078] The guide groove 811 is fixedly connected to the side of the first fixing ring 1 close to the second fixing ring 2. The ring gear 812 is fixed in the guide groove 811. There are two first rotating shafts 813, which are respectively rotatably passed through the two support rods 31 of the mounting frame 3 where the welding gun 4 is located. There are two first gears 814 and two second gears 815, and each corresponds to the first rotating shaft 813 one by one. The first gear 814 is fixedly connected to one end of the first rotating shaft 813, and the first gear 814 is slidably set in the guide groove 811 and meshed with the ring gear 812. The second gear 815 is fixedly connected to the other end of the first rotating shaft 813. The third gear 816 is located between the two second gears 815 and meshed with both second gears 815. The motor 817 is fixedly connected to the second fixing ring 2, and the output shaft of the motor 817 is fixedly connected to the third gear 816.
[0079] When welding, start the motor 817, the motor 817 drives the third gear 816 to rotate, the third gear 816 drives the two second gears 815 to rotate, the second gear 815 drives the first rotating shaft 813 to rotate, the first rotating shaft 813 drives the first gear 814 to rotate, and under the drive of the ring gear 812, the first gear 814 rotates around the pipe pile in the guide groove 811, so that the mounting frame 3 and the second fixing ring 2 can rotate around the pipe pile.
[0080] In particular, the guide groove 811 includes two semicircular semi-guide grooves, and the two semi-guide grooves are respectively fixed on the two fixed semi-rings 12 of the first fixed ring 1. Through the two semi-guide grooves, the guide groove 811 is easy to be mounted on the pipe pile; the gear ring 812 includes two semicircular semi-gear rings, and the two semi-gear rings are respectively fixed in the two semi-guide grooves. Through the two semi-gear rings, the gear ring 812 is easy to be mounted on the pipe pile.
[0081] Specifically, refer to Figure 2 、 Figure 3 and Figure 5 The second driving part 82 includes a second rotating shaft 821 , a fourth gear 822 , a synchronous pulley 823 , a cleaning pulley 824 and a synchronous driving belt 825 .
[0082] Two second rotating shafts 821 are provided, each rotatably extending through the two support rods 31 of the mounting frame 3 on which the cleaning grinding head 5 is mounted. Two fourth gears 822 and two synchronous pulleys 823 are provided, each corresponding one-to-one with the second rotating shaft 821. The fourth gear 822 is fixedly connected to one end of the second rotating shaft 821, slidably disposed within the guide groove 811, and meshes with the ring gear 812. The synchronous pulley 823 is slidably mounted on the second rotating shaft 821. The second rotating shaft 821 is used to drive the synchronous pulley 823 to rotate. The synchronous pulley 823 is slidably disposed within the clearance slot 311 defined in the support rod 31. The cleaning grinding head 5 is rotatably connected to the movable end of the second adjustment cylinder 73, and the cleaning pulley 824 is fixedly connected to the cleaning grinding head 5. A synchronous drive belt 825 is wound around the two synchronous pulleys 823 and the cleaning pulley 824.
[0083] When the two mounting frames 3 and the second fixed ring 2 rotate around the pipe pile, the fourth gear 822 can rotate under the drive of the ring gear 812, and the fourth gear 822 drives the second rotating shaft 821 to rotate, and the second rotating shaft 821 drives the synchronous pulley 823 to rotate, and the synchronous pulley 823 drives the synchronous drive belt 825 to rotate, and the synchronous drive belt 825 drives the cleaning pulley 824 to rotate, and the cleaning pulley 824 drives the cleaning grinding head 5 to rotate, so that the cleaning grinding head 5 can use the driving force generated by the rotation of the mounting frame 3 to automatically rotate when the welding gun 4 rotates for welding.
[0084] In particular, refer to Figure 3 A slider 8231 is fixedly connected to the synchronous pulley 823, and the slider 8231 is slidably set in the adjustment slot 8211 opened on the second rotating shaft 821. Through the clamping action of the slider 8231 and the adjustment slot 8211, the second rotating shaft 821 can drive the synchronous pulley 823 to rotate.
[0085] Further, refer to Figure 3 A tensioning pulley 826 is wound around the inner side of the synchronous drive belt 825, and the tensioning pulley 826 is connected to the telescopic rod 827, and the tensioning pulley 826 is rotatably connected to the movable end of the telescopic rod 827, and the telescopic rod 827 is fixedly connected to the mounting slide 32. A fourth spring 828 is provided in the rodless cavity of the telescopic rod 827, one end of the fourth spring 828 is fixedly connected to the fixed end of the telescopic rod 827, and the other end is fixedly connected to the movable end of the telescopic rod 827. The fourth spring 828 is used to drive the telescopic rod 827 to extend.
[0086] When the second adjusting cylinder 73 adjusts the position of the cleaning grinding head 5, the cleaning grinding head 5 can make the cleaning pulley 824 approach the pipe pile synchronously, and the cleaning pulley 824 can push the synchronous drive belt 825 close to the pipe pile. Since the circumference of the synchronous drive belt 825 is fixed, the synchronous drive belt 825 can pull the tensioning pulley 826 close to the pipe pile, and the tensioning pulley 826 drives the telescopic rod 827 to contract, so that the fourth spring 828 accumulates elastic force. Under the action of the elastic force of the fourth spring 828, the synchronous drive belt 825 can always be in a tensioned state, so that the synchronous drive belt 825 is not easy to affect the adjustment of the position of the cleaning grinding head 5.
[0087] The implementation principle of an automatic pipe pile welding device according to an embodiment of the present application is as follows: when in use, the first fixing ring 1 and the second fixing ring 2 are sleeved on the pipe pile, the slide 32 is slidably installed, so that the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 are both aligned with the welding positions of the two pipe piles, the first fixing oil cylinder 11 fixes the first fixing ring 1 on the pipe pile, and the slide 32 and the support rod 31 are fixedly installed, the second fixing oil cylinder 21 fixes the second fixing ring 2 on the pipe pile, and adjusts the welding gun 4 and the cleaning grinding head 5 to the welding working position, starts the motor 817, and the motor 817 drives the mounting frame 3 and the second fixing ring 2 to rotate around the pipe pile, and the cleaning grinding head 5 rotates with the help of the driving force generated by the rotation of the mounting frame 3, the cleaning grinding head 5 grinds and cleans the welding part of the pipe pile, and the welding gun 4 welds the pipe pile, thereby improving the degree of automation of on-site welding of the pipe piles and making the welding quality of the pipe piles easy to stabilize.
